3种制氢技术路线的经济性分析

为分析不同制氢技术路线的成本,选取了天然气制氢、石油制氢、电解水制氢3种制氢方式来测算制氢成本.其中,天然气的制氢成本最低,石油制氢的成本最高.分析了3种制氢方式的成本组成,发现制氢成本的主要部分都是原料/电力成本.讨论了原料/电力成本、设备投资、碳税税率3个变量对氢气价格的影响,得出原料/电力成本对氢气价格的影响远大于设备投资、碳税税率的结论.
In order to analyze the cost of different hydrogen production technology routes,this paper selected three hydro-gen production technologies,i.e.,hydrogen production from natural gas,from petroleum,and by electrocatalytic water splitting,and calculated the cost of these methods.Among them,the cost of natural gas hydrogen production is the low-est,and the cost of petroleum hydrogen production is the highest.The cost composition of three hydrogen production methods is analyzed,and it is concluded that the main part of the cost is raw materials/electricity in the three hydrogen production methods.The effects of raw material/electricity cost,equipment investment and carbon tax rate on hydrogen price are discussed.It is concluded that the impact of raw material/electricity costs on hydrogen prices is much greater than that of equipment investment and carbon tax rates.
